										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Olivia Cooke, age 32, is set to reprise her role as Alicent Hightower in the highly anticipated third season of <strong>House of the Dragon</strong>, scheduled to return in summer 2026. The series, which will run for a total of four seasons, has captivated audiences since its debut.</p>
<p>Cooke recently appeared on <strong>The Claudia Winkleman Show</strong> alongside notable guests including Ralph Fiennes, Anna Faris, and Michelle de Swarte. During the show, she shared a humorous anecdote about a prank involving a merkin that shocked her co-star Fabien Frankel.</p>
<p>Reflecting on her experiences in the industry, Cooke admitted her discomfort with red carpet events, stating, &#8220;When you’ve got all those people screaming at you, my reaction is to want to cry or run away.&#8221; This sentiment highlights the pressures that come with fame.</p>
<p>Despite her reservations about the spotlight, Cooke&#8217;s mother enjoys the perks of her daughter&#8217;s celebrity status, benefiting from the free gifts that come with it. Cooke&#8217;s candidness about her experiences adds a relatable dimension to her public persona.</p>
<p>In the upcoming season, fans can expect thrilling developments, including the much-anticipated Battle of the Gullet, as teased in the latest promotional materials. This battle is expected to be a pivotal moment in the storyline.</p>
<p>Cooke&#8217;s portrayal of Alicent Hightower has garnered significant attention, especially following her performance in the previous seasons. She has previously stated, &#8220;But I had to do a sex scene where my scene partner was underneath my skirts. You can imagine what was happening,&#8221; illustrating the complexities of her role.</p>
<p>As the series progresses, viewers are eager to see how Cooke&#8217;s character evolves and what challenges lie ahead. The anticipation for the third season continues to build, with fans eagerly awaiting its release.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;I remember being just so scared that I was gonna get fired because I had no body of work behind me. I didn&#8217;t even have an agent,&#8221; Anna Faris shared, reflecting on her early days in Hollywood during a recent event.</p>
<p>Faris, now 49, is best known for her role as Cindy Campbell in the <strong>Scary Movie</strong> franchise, which began with the release of the first film in 2000. Her journey in the film industry has been marked by both anxiety and triumph, particularly during the filming of the original movies.</p>
<p>Looking back, she described feeling intimidated and quiet while shooting the first two installments of <strong>Scary Movie</strong>. However, by the time she filmed <strong>Scary Movie 3</strong> in 2003, she felt more at ease, stating, &#8220;For me, it felt like I got to pay more attention. I did get to involve myself more.&#8221; This shift in confidence has been pivotal in her career.</p>
<p>Faris is set to reprise her iconic role in <strong>Scary Movie 6</strong>, scheduled for release on June 5, 2026. The anticipation surrounding this film has reignited interest in her earlier works and the impact they had on her career.</p>
<p>In a recent appearance as the Bubblegum Troll mascot from <strong>Candy Crush</strong> at a <strong>Los Angeles Clippers</strong> game, Faris expressed gratitude towards the Wayans brothers for giving her a chance in the original films. &#8220;It felt like such a victory&#8230; It’s like the cherry on top that audiences are so excited to see it,&#8221; she remarked, highlighting her appreciation for the opportunities she has received.</p>
<p>The collaboration between <strong>Candy Crush</strong> and the <strong>Los Angeles Clippers</strong> aims to enhance fan engagement through immersive experiences, with Faris&#8217; involvement raising questions about celebrity participation in brand storytelling. &#8220;This moment also raises a deeper question about celebrity in brand storytelling,&#8221; she noted, emphasizing the evolving role of celebrities in marketing.</p>
<p>Faris&#8217; participation in the Candy Crush event underscores her ongoing relevance in both the film and entertainment industries, as she navigates her career with a blend of nostalgia and innovation.</p>
